How busy is Death Valley in May?

May rates 8/10 for crowds (Busy) at Death Valley National Park — about 79% of its busiest month. Typical recreation visits: 119,480.

What is the weather like at Death Valley in May?

In May, Death Valley averages a high of 98°F and a low of 73°F, with about 0.1 inches of precipitation.
